Overview
Fuzz Faster U Fool is a security scanner from ffuf used for security scanning, malware checks, vulnerability assessment, certificate review, and site-safety analysis.
Its primary user-agent pattern is Fuzz Faster U Fool.
Fuzz Faster U Fool is Unverified at the identity-evidence level. The listed identity remains useful for detection, but this record does not currently contain authoritative evidence sufficient to authenticate the identity claim.
Robots.txt behavior is not currently confirmed.
Fuzz Faster U Fool should be blocked or tightly restricted unless the traffic is required for a verified business purpose.

- Detection Notes
- Fuzz Faster U Fool traffic is primarily detected by the `Fuzz Faster U Fool` user-agent pattern. Compare source IPs, reverse DNS, request paths, and crawl cadence with ffuf infrastructure before trusting the traffic.
- Respects robots.txt
- Unknown
- Spoofing Risk
- Fuzz Faster U Fool has medium spoofing risk because user-agent strings can be copied; pair the match with DNS, IP, behavior, or operator evidence.
